Schussboomer was a steel wild mouse roller coaster at Worlds of Fun theme park in Kansas City, Missouri. The ride was dismantled in 1984. It was named after a skier who schusses, one who skis fast and straight.

this was one of the best rides ever at world's of fun!! it was like a full bowl of spaghetti where the noodles are the rails you ride! it went back and down and up and forth almost frantically with the thrills of a possible collision or certain decapitation! described by wiki as being 1500 ft long and 40 ft high, and every bit of it was crammed in a space less than 40 x 40 ft !!! hands down, it is the most unpredictable and mind boggling experience i ever had on a rigid, unmovable metal structure. i have wanted to ride it again with all my might since the day they took it away from all of us in 1984.
